Meat & Poultry Processing Plant MRO Services Market Summary

As per MRFR analysis, the Meat & Poultry Processing Plant MRO Services Market was estimated at 5.2 USD Billion in 2024. The market is projected to grow from 5.46 USD Billion in 2025 to 8.9 USD Billion by 2035, exhibiting a compound annual growth rate (CAGR) of 5.01% during the forecast period 2025 - 2035.

Meat & Poultry Processing Plant MRO Services Market Drivers

Regulatory Compliance

Regulatory compliance remains a fundamental driver in the Meat & Poultry Processing Plant MRO Services Market. The sector is subject to rigorous health and safety standards, necessitating regular maintenance and inspections of equipment. Compliance with these regulations is not merely a legal obligation; it also serves to protect public health and enhance product quality. The financial implications of non-compliance can be severe, including fines and reputational damage. Consequently, processing plants are increasingly investing in MRO services to ensure adherence to these regulations, thereby driving growth in the Meat & Poultry Processing Plant MRO Services Market.

Sustainability Initiatives

Sustainability initiatives are becoming a pivotal driver in the Meat & Poultry Processing Plant MRO Services Market. As consumers increasingly demand environmentally friendly practices, processing plants are compelled to adopt sustainable maintenance solutions. This includes the use of eco-friendly materials and energy-efficient machinery. Reports indicate that the market for sustainable MRO services is expanding, with a notable increase in investments directed towards green technologies. Such initiatives not only align with consumer preferences but also help companies comply with stringent environmental regulations, thereby enhancing their market position within the Meat & Poultry Processing Plant MRO Services Market.

Technological Advancements

The Meat & Poultry Processing Plant MRO Services Market is experiencing a surge in technological advancements that enhance operational efficiency. Automation and smart technologies are increasingly integrated into maintenance, repair, and operations processes. For instance, predictive maintenance tools utilize data analytics to foresee equipment failures, thereby reducing downtime. The market for such technologies is projected to grow significantly, with estimates suggesting a compound annual growth rate of over 10% in the coming years. This trend not only streamlines operations but also reduces costs associated with unplanned maintenance, making it a critical driver in the Meat & Poultry Processing Plant MRO Services Market.

Regional Insights

North America : Market Leader in MRO Services

North America is poised to maintain its leadership in the Meat & Poultry Processing Plant MRO Services Market, holding a significant market share of $2.8B in 2025. Key growth drivers include increasing demand for processed meat products, stringent food safety regulations, and advancements in processing technologies. The region's robust infrastructure and investment in automation further enhance operational efficiency, making it a prime location for MRO services. The competitive landscape is dominated by major players such as Tyson Foods, Cargill, and JBS, which are continuously innovating to meet consumer demands. The U.S. and Canada are the leading countries, benefiting from a well-established supply chain and a focus on sustainability. The presence of these key players ensures a dynamic market environment, fostering growth and innovation in MRO services.

Europe : Emerging Market with Growth Potential

Europe's Meat & Poultry Processing Plant MRO Services Market is valued at $1.5B in 2025, driven by increasing consumer demand for high-quality meat products and compliance with stringent EU regulations.
